Is 0800 numbers free on mobiles?

0800 and 0808: Freephone Calls are free of charge from all consumer landlines and mobile phones. If you are calling from a business phone, you should check with your provider whether there will be a charge for calling 0800 or 0808.

What is BT public Internet service?

BT Wi-fi (inc. BT Openzone) is a wireless broadband (wi-fi) service that you can access in public places (hotspots) such as airports, hotels, coffee shops, motorway service stations and city centres.

How to make a complaint about BT Broadband?

You can also submit a written complaint using the online contact form. If you cannot reach a satisfactory resolution with BT you can submit a complaint to the ombudsman. Each provider is a member of one of two ADR (Alternative Dispute Resolution) schemes; for BT Broadband you need to contact Ombudsman Service: Communication .
